Why is gymnastics dangerous?

Gymnastics is a high-impact sport, and one misstep can cause serious injuries. Broken bones and serious sprains are common among gymnasts. When children break bones along a bone’s growth plate, the bone may stop growing. Breaks that do not heal correctly can cause crooked posture, difficulty moving and long-term pain.

Why are gymnasts so short?

By moving their arms in, they’ve decreased the amount of weight that’s far away from the axis of rotation and they’ve decreased their moment of inertia, making it easier for them to spin at high speed. The smaller a gymnast is, the easier it is for her to rotate in the air.

Do gymnasts get periods?

Many elite women gymnasts, and some other endurance athletes like distance runners, are amenorrheal, or experiencing a significant delay in the onset of menstruation and puberty. It is routine for top-flight gymnasts to begin menstruating years later than other girls.

How many gymnasts get injured in a year?

Most non-professional gymnasts face injuries due to poor spotting or balance beam activities. 64% of all gymnastics injuries will impact the lower body. Studies show that up to 70% of injuries among female gymnasts involve the lower extremities, up to 25% target the upper extremities, and nearly 17% of injuries hurt the spine or trunk.
